US Aircraft Crash in Iraq Kills Six Crew Members

Investigation begins after a military aircraft accident raises questions about safety, operational conditions, and regional security dynamics.

By Saad Published a day ago 5 min read



Introduction

A United States military aircraft crash in Iraq has resulted in the deaths of six crew members, according to initial reports cited by international media outlets. The incident has drawn attention from defense officials and government representatives who are now investigating the cause of the crash.

Military aviation accidents are rare but significant events because they involve trained personnel, complex aircraft systems, and missions that often occur in challenging environments. The crash has raised questions about operational safety, maintenance conditions, and the broader context of military activity in the region.

Authorities have stated that investigations will continue until a clear understanding of the incident is established. The loss of crew members has also prompted expressions of condolences from military leaders and government officials.



Details of the Aircraft Crash

Initial reports indicate that the aircraft went down during an operational mission within Iraqi territory. Defense officials confirmed that six crew members were onboard at the time of the accident and that none survived.

The precise location of the crash has not been fully disclosed due to operational security considerations. However, officials confirmed that recovery teams were dispatched soon after the incident occurred.

Military investigators will analyze several possible factors, including mechanical malfunction, environmental conditions, and operational challenges. Such investigations often involve detailed examination of flight records, aircraft components, and communication logs.

Until the investigation is complete, authorities have emphasized that any conclusions about the cause of the crash would remain preliminary.
